Gérard Didier is a contemporary French sculptor. He embarked on a creative journey four decades ago that would lead him to master the art of direct stone cutting from the Haute Ardèche region. A self-taught artist, he gradually honed his craft by learning to merge the use of tools with the inherent forms found in nature and the tactile textures of various materials.

In addition to his artistic pursuits, Gérard Didier made significant contributions to the world of education. He co-founded the Plastic Arts-Studies sector at INSA (Institut National des Sciences Appliquées), where he assumed the role of leading the sculpture workshop from 1987 to 2003.

Gérard's early sculptural works primarily featured granite and basalt, showcasing his deep affinity for these geological materials. His talent was recognized with exhibitions at prestigious events such as the Salon d'Automne in 1982 and the Salon d'Hiver in 1986, where he earned a sculpture prize.

Over time, Gérard's artistic exploration expanded to include wood, a medium rich in history and character. His sculptures breathed life into the stories, both peaceful and tormented, held within the grains of this versatile material.

Throughout his career, Gérard Didier's works found their way into various collective and solo exhibitions in the Rhône-Alpes region of France. His art graced venues such as the Université Claude Bernard, the Faculty of Medicine, the Center des Clubs - Alexandre Bonjean, and more, captivating audiences with its unique blend of craftsmanship and creative expression.

From the tranquil confines of the Sainte Marguerite Chapel in Sainte-Foy-lès-Lyon to the bustling Salon des Indépendants de Bron, Gérard's sculptures were a testament to his unwavering dedication to his craft. His work continued to be showcased at numerous events, galleries, and exhibitions.
